mysql锁死的现象判断
Posted 安子
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了mysql锁死的现象判断相关的知识,希望对你有一定的参考价值。
一般发生表锁死这种低级问题,就有两种情况:1、程序员水平太菜,2、程序逻辑错误。
一旦发生系统会出现超时,关键是有可能你看不到正在活动的php进程,而系统的慢查询日志也不会记录,只能通过show full processlist去看,
如果有条件的话,完全可以定时去执行这个命令mysql -uuser -h127.0.0.1 -p -e "show full processlist">mysqlp.txt,然后去检测这个txt文件。
以上是关于mysql锁死的现象判断的主要内容,如果未能解决你的问题,请参考以下文章
MySQL - 全局锁表级锁行级锁元数据锁自增锁意向锁共享锁独占锁记录锁间隙锁临键锁死锁